... CAS 2 SP/EN 5 82C59A 82C59A The Programmable Interrupt Controller (PlC) functions as an overall manager in an Interrupt-Driven system. It accepts requests from the peripheral equipment, determines which of the incoming requests is of the highest importance (priority), ascertains whether the incoming request has a higher priority value than the level currently being serviced, and issues an interrupt to the CPU based on this determination ...
